Mixed Signal Oscilloscope Power and Current Measurement System
Mixed Signal Oscilloscope Power and Current Measurement System is a published development and funding opportunity on Contexium. The donor or funder is ENERGY, DEPARTMENT OF. Project location(s): United States. Applications close on 23 Sep 2026. UT-Battelle, LLC is the management and operating contractor of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L). The Buildings and Transportation Science Division at ORNL is in need of a bundle of Mixed Signal Oscilloscope Power and Current Measurement System or equivalent.
